Tube feeding a baby kitten is a delicate, often life-saving procedure used when neonates or very young kittens cannot nurse or take a bottle. It should be undertaken only when necessary and ideally under veterinary guidance, since improper technique can cause aspiration pneumonia, injury, or metabolic imbalance.

The Lifeline: When Tube Feeding is "Better" for Neonatal Kittens
In the world of kitten rescue, "baby kitten tube better" refers to a critical crossroad in care. While bottle feeding is the gold standard for healthy, active neonates, tube feeding (orogastric feeding) becomes the "better" or even necessary choice in specific life-saving scenarios. Why Choose Tube Over Bottle?
While bottle feeding mimics natural nursing, it has significant drawbacks for vulnerable kittens that make tube feeding a superior alternative in certain cases:
Safety & Aspiration Risk: Weak kittens often have a poor suckle reflex. Forcing a bottle or syringe on a kitten that isn't actively sucking can cause formula to enter the lungs (aspiration), leading to fatal pneumonia.
Efficiency for Large Litters: Tube feeding is significantly faster than bottle feeding. For rescuers managing large litters, it allows every kitten to be fed quickly and accurately, ensuring no one is left behind.
Precision in Nutrition: It eliminates the guesswork of "messy eaters." With a tube, you know exactly how many cubic centimeters (cc) reached the stomach, which is vital for tracking growth in critical neonates.
Overcoming Medical Barriers: For kittens with cleft palates, facial trauma, or extreme weakness from illness (like hypoglycemia or hypothermia), a tube is often the only way to deliver life-saving nutrients. When Is It "Better" to Use a Tube?
Experts recommend transitioning to tube feeding if a kitten displays any of the following:
Absence of Suckle Reflex: If a neonate cannot latch or suck, tube feeding provides immediate hydration and calories.
Anorexia or Refusal: Healthy kittens may occasionally refuse a bottle; however, if they miss multiple feedings, a tube ensures they don't spiral into a "fading kitten" state.
Severe Illness: Kittens fighting infections or congenital defects often lack the energy to eat orally. Critical Safety Warnings
Tube feeding is a medical procedure. If done incorrectly—such as placing the tube in the trachea (lungs) instead of the esophagus—it can be immediately fatal.
Professional Training Required: Never attempt to tube feed without in-person guidance from a veterinarian or an experienced licensed rehabilitator.
Temperature Check: Never feed a cold kitten. They must be warmed to their appropriate age-based body temperature (95°F–101°F) before they can digest food.
Measurement is Key: Always measure from the nose to the last rib to ensure the tube reaches the stomach.

A play tube isn't just a toy; it’s a multi-purpose tool for a growing kitten.
Natural Instincts: It mimics the "burrowing" behavior kittens naturally crave.
Safe Space: Provides an instant retreat when they feel overstimulated. Exercise: Encourages "zoomies" and high-energy pouncing.
Texture Variety: Many tubes feature crinkle material that stimulates hearing. Features of a "Better" Kitten Tube
To find a high-quality option that lasts past the "kitten phase," look for these specifics:
Collapsible Design: Must fold flat for easy storage and travel.
Durable Lining: Look for tear-resistant polyester to survive sharp kitten claws.
Peep Holes: Multiple exits prevent the kitten from feeling trapped.
Hanging Toys: Internal bells or feathers add an extra layer of engagement.
Washable Fabric: Kittens are messy; a machine-washable cover is a huge plus. Training & Play Tips Maximize the fun with these simple steps:
The Reveal: Place a treat inside the tube to encourage the first entry.
Interactive Play: Drag a wand toy across the outside so they "hunt" the sound.
The Connection: Attach two tubes together to create a complex maze.

The phrase "baby kxtten tube better" appears to combine a specialized feline care technique with an innovative training tool for animal rescuers. A "baby kxtten" (often a stylized or emphasized term for a neonatal kitten) typically refers to an orphaned or "bottle baby" feline that requires intensive care. "Tube better" refers to the goal of improving tube feeding—a critical, life-saving skill for kittens who cannot or will not eat on their own. Understanding Tube Feeding for Neonatal Kittens
Tube feeding is a method of delivering liquid nutrition directly to a kitten's stomach via a soft, flexible tube. It is often used for:
Orphaned "Bottle Babies": Kittens without a mother who struggle to latch onto a bottle.
Medical Support: Kittens suffering from fading kitten syndrome or severe viruses that require consistent hydration and caloric intake.
Weight Gain: Ensuring fragile kittens, such as the black kitten "Grumpy" mentioned in rescue reports, receive enough formula to grow stronger. "Tubert": The Tool for a "Better Tube"
To help caregivers "tube better," veterinary institutions like the UC Davis School of Veterinary Medicine have developed realistic 3D-printed models to practice the skill without risking a live animal.
"Tubert" and "Tubitha": These are true-to-scale neonatal kitten models used for teaching.
Realistic Anatomy: They feature a realistic ribcage, esophagus, and trachea, allowing students to learn exactly where to place the tube to avoid the lungs.
Accessibility: This technology makes specialized training more accessible to foster parents and veterinary students alike. Tips for Better Success
Practice on Models: Use specialized tools like the UC Davis 3D-Printed Models before attempting the procedure on a live kitten.
Monitor Latching: Watch for the transition to oral feeding. Even a few milliliters (MLs) of oral formula is a positive sign of strengthening.
